An effort is made to formulate a theoretical foundation for methods which obtain the orbital parameters of the Uranian rings by fitting precessing inclined ellipses with constant elliptic elements and precession rates onto ring-occultation data. It is shown that ring shapes and evolution are best described in terms of epicyclic elements that most nearly approximate the geometric elements obtained from ring occultation data. It is also suggested that epicyclic elements be used in place of elliptic elements in treatments of ring problems, in order to improve data fits and preclude theoretical inconsistencies.
